## What is CRYPT.FINANCE?

Crypt Finance is an algorithmic stable coin protocol pegged 1:1 to TOMB on Fantom. Much like Tomb Finance, our protocol uses three tokens (SKULL, GRAIL, CRYPT) to incentivise a stable 1:1 peg to TOMB. The protocol's underlying mechanism dynamically adjusts SKULL's supply, pushing its price up or down relative to the price TOMB.
